DESCRIPTION:No. 49404
Mineral:Anhydrite with Calcite
Locality:Naica District, Saucillo, Chihuahua, Mexico
Description:Translucent tapered compound crystal of pale-blue anhydrite 28 mm long with the rear and sides completely overgrown with translucent gray scalenohedral calcite crystals to 4 mm and a second generation of anhydrite microcrystals.
Overall Size:7x5x1.2 cm
Crystals:micro to 68 mm
